A SMOOTHED FINITE ELEMENT METHOD FOR HEAT TRANSFER PROBLEMS

By smoothing, a family of smoothed FEM (S-FEM) has been developed recently. It possesses the advantages of both meshfree methods and the standards FEM, and works well with triangular and tetrahedral types of background cells/elements. This paper presents the general formulation of S-FEM for thermal problems in one, two and three dimensions. To examine our formulation, computational results are compared with those obtained using other established means.
